Syngenta is a global agricultural science and technology company headquartered in Basel, Switzerland, and part of the Syngenta Group, which is owned by China National Chemical Corporation (ChemChina) and Sinochem. Founded in 2000 through the merger of Novartis Agribusiness and Zeneca Agrochemicals, the company focuses on developing crop protection products and high-quality seeds to help farmers improve productivity and sustainability. Syngenta employs tens of thousands of people worldwide and operates in more than 100 countries, serving farmers ranging from smallholders to large commercial agricultural operations.The company’s mission centers on advancing sustainable agriculture by helping growers increase crop yields while minimizing environmental impact. Syngenta’s portfolio includes herbicides, insecticides, fungicides, hybrid seeds, biological solutions, and digital agriculture tools. Recognized as one of the leading players in the global agrochemical and seed markets, the company continues to invest heavily in research and development, including innovations in biological crop protection and climate-resilient seeds to address global food security challenges.

SYSTRA is a global engineering and consulting group specializing in public transport and mobility infrastructure, with a strong focus on rail, metro, and urban transit systems. Headquartered in Paris, France, the company was founded in 1957 and has grown into one of the world’s leading specialists in transport engineering. With more than 10,000 employees across dozens of countries, SYSTRA provides services that span the full lifecycle of transportation projects, including feasibility studies, design, project management, systems integration, and operations support.The company’s mission is to design safe, efficient, and sustainable mobility solutions that help cities and regions develop modern transportation networks. SYSTRA has contributed to many high-profile projects worldwide, including high‑speed rail lines, metro systems, and large-scale urban mobility programs. Its expertise has been applied to projects such as the Grand Paris Express, metro networks across Asia and the Middle East, and rail infrastructure developments in Europe and India. Known for deep technical expertise in rail systems and transit engineering, SYSTRA is widely regarded as a trusted advisor for complex transportation infrastructure projects globally.

The Tata Group is one of India's largest and most respected multinational conglomerates, founded in 1868 by Jamsetji Tata. Headquartered in Mumbai, India, the group operates across more than 100 countries and encompasses over 30 publicly listed companies, including Tata Consultancy Services (TCS), Tata Motors, Tata Steel, Tata Power, Tata Chemicals, Tata Consumer Products, and Tata Communications. With a workforce exceeding 935,000 employees globally, Tata has built a reputation for ethical business practices, innovation, and a strong commitment to community development.The group's mission is to improve the quality of life of the communities it serves globally, through long-term stakeholder value creation based on leadership with trust. Tata companies operate in diverse sectors such as IT services, automotive, steel, energy, consumer goods, hospitality, and telecommunications. In recent years, Tata has made headlines for its ambitious sustainability goals, expansion into electric vehicles, and strategic acquisitions, including the high-profile purchase of Air India in 2022, marking a significant milestone in India's aviation sector.

Tata 1mg is an Indian digital healthcare platform that provides online pharmacy, diagnostics, teleconsultation, and health information services. Founded in 2015 (evolving from the earlier HealthKartPlus platform) and headquartered in Gurugram, Haryana, the company aims to make healthcare accessible, understandable, and affordable for consumers across India. Through its mobile app and website, Tata 1mg enables users to order prescription medicines, book lab tests, consult doctors online, and access a large library of verified medical information. The platform partners with licensed pharmacies and diagnostic labs while also operating its own logistics and lab networks in several cities.In 2021, Tata Digital acquired a majority stake in 1mg, integrating it into the broader Tata ecosystem and strengthening its position in India's rapidly growing digital health and e-pharmacy market. The company has grown to employ over a thousand people and serves millions of customers nationwide. Known for its strong brand credibility and technology-driven healthcare services, Tata 1mg is considered one of the leading players in India's online pharmacy and health-tech sector, competing with platforms such as PharmEasy and Netmeds.

Tata Motors Limited is a leading global automobile manufacturer headquartered in Mumbai, India. Founded in 1945, the company is part of the Tata Group, one of India's largest and most respected industrial conglomerates. Tata Motors designs, manufactures, and sells a wide range of vehicles, including cars, trucks, buses, vans, and construction equipment, serving both domestic and international markets. With over 80,000 employees worldwide, it operates manufacturing plants in India, the UK, South Korea, Thailand, South Africa, and other locations, and has a strong presence in more than 125 countries.The company's mission is to innovate mobility solutions that improve quality of life, with a focus on sustainability, safety, and affordability. Tata Motors is well-known for its acquisition of Jaguar Land Rover in 2008, which significantly expanded its global footprint and luxury vehicle portfolio. In recent years, Tata Motors has been recognized for its advancements in electric vehicle technology, including the launch of the Tata Nexon EV, which has become one of India's best-selling electric SUVs. The company continues to invest in green mobility, digitalization, and smart manufacturing to strengthen its market position and meet evolving consumer demands.

Tekion is a cloud-based enterprise software company that develops modern technology platforms for the automotive retail industry. Founded in 2016 by Jay Vijayan, former CIO of Tesla, the company’s mission is to transform the automotive retail experience through a unified, data-driven cloud platform. Tekion’s flagship product, Automotive Retail Cloud (ARC), provides dealerships, OEMs, and automotive retailers with an end-to-end system that integrates dealership management, digital retailing, customer experience, and data analytics into a single platform.Headquartered in Pleasanton, California, Tekion has grown rapidly and employs over a thousand people globally, with major engineering operations in India. The company is widely recognized for disrupting traditional dealership management systems with a modern SaaS architecture. Tekion has secured significant venture funding and achieved unicorn status, and it has formed strategic relationships with major automakers and dealer groups, positioning itself as an emerging leader in automotive retail technology.

Textron Inc. is a diversified, multinational industrial conglomerate headquartered in Providence, Rhode Island, USA. Founded in 1923, the company operates across multiple sectors including aerospace, defense, industrial, and finance. Textron's portfolio encompasses well-known brands such as Bell Helicopter, Cessna Aircraft, Beechcraft, and Textron Systems, making it a significant player in both commercial and military markets. With over 30,000 employees worldwide, Textron's mission is to deliver innovative products and services that meet the evolving needs of its customers while maintaining a strong commitment to quality, safety, and operational excellence.Textron has a robust market position, recognized for its engineering expertise, manufacturing capabilities, and global reach. In recent years, the company has expanded its offerings in unmanned systems, advanced aircraft, and electric propulsion technologies, reflecting its focus on innovation and sustainability. Notably, Textron has been involved in the development of next-generation vertical lift aircraft for the U.S. Army and has continued to strengthen its presence in business aviation through new aircraft launches and enhancements to its service network.

The TJX Companies, Inc. is a leading multinational off-price retailer of apparel and home fashions, headquartered in Framingham, Massachusetts, USA. Founded in 1976, TJX operates a portfolio of well-known retail brands including T.J. Maxx, Marshalls, HomeGoods, Sierra, and Winners, offering high-quality, fashionable merchandise at prices generally lower than traditional department and specialty stores. With a mission to deliver great value to customers every day, TJX sources products from thousands of vendors worldwide, providing a constantly changing assortment that keeps shoppers engaged and returning.As of recent years, TJX has grown to become one of the largest apparel and home fashion retailers in the world, employing over 300,000 associates across more than 4,800 stores in nine countries, along with a growing e-commerce presence. The company is recognized for its strong financial performance, resilient business model, and ability to adapt to changing retail landscapes. Recent strategic initiatives include expanding its global footprint, enhancing supply chain efficiency, and investing in digital capabilities to complement its brick-and-mortar operations.
